How they compare

Sierra Leone currently reports 8.21 per 1,000 people against 8.02 per 1,000 people in Liberia, a difference of 0.19 per 1,000 people.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 65 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Sierra Leone ahead.

Liberia ranks 81st and Sierra Leone ranks 78th of 218 countries.

Sierra Leone has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Liberia Sierra Leone Difference Ahead
1960s 25.4 per 1,000 people 29.07 per 1,000 people 3.67 per 1,000 people Sierra Leone
1970s 22.34 per 1,000 people 24.85 per 1,000 people 2.51 per 1,000 people Sierra Leone
1980s 20.59 per 1,000 people 22.35 per 1,000 people 1.75 per 1,000 people Sierra Leone
1990s 20.03 per 1,000 people 22.13 per 1,000 people 2.09 per 1,000 people Sierra Leone
2000s 12.16 per 1,000 people 17.27 per 1,000 people 5.11 per 1,000 people Sierra Leone
2010s 9.24 per 1,000 people 11.77 per 1,000 people 2.53 per 1,000 people Sierra Leone
2020s 8.25 per 1,000 people 8.67 per 1,000 people 0.4166 per 1,000 people Sierra Leone

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Crude death rate indicates the number of deaths occurring during the year, per 1,000 population estimated at midyear. Subtracting the crude death rate from the crude birth rate provides the rate of natural increase, which is equal to the rate of population change in the absence of migration.
